// UNSUPPORTED: c++03, c++11, c++14, c++17
// <list>
// template <class T, class Allocator, class U>
// typename list<T, Allocator>::size_type
// erase(list<T, Allocator>& c, const U& value);
#include <list>
#include <optional>
#include "test_macros.h"
#include "test_allocator.h"
#include "min_allocator.h"
template <class S, class U>
void test0(S s, U val, S expected, std::size_t expected_erased_count) {
ASSERT_SAME_TYPE(typename S::size_type, decltype(std::erase(s, val)));
assert(expected_erased_count == std::erase(s, val));
assert(s == expected);
}
template <class S>
void test()
{
test0(S(), 1, S(), 0);
test0(S({1}), 1, S(), 1);
test0(S({1}), 2, S({1}), 0);
test0(S({1, 2}), 1, S({2}), 1);
test0(S({1, 2}), 2, S({1}), 1);
test0(S({1, 2}), 3, S({1, 2}), 0);
test0(S({1, 1}), 1, S(), 2);
test0(S({1, 1}), 3, S({1, 1}), 0);
test0(S({1, 2, 3}), 1, S({2, 3}), 1);
test0(S({1, 2, 3}), 2, S({1, 3}), 1);
test0(S({1, 2, 3}), 3, S({1, 2}), 1);
test0(S({1, 2, 3}), 4, S({1, 2, 3}), 0);
test0(S({1, 1, 1}), 1, S(), 3);
test0(S({1, 1, 1}), 2, S({1, 1, 1}), 0);
test0(S({1, 1, 2}), 1, S({2}), 2);
test0(S({1, 1, 2}), 2, S({1, 1}), 1);
test0(S({1, 1, 2}), 3, S({1, 1, 2}), 0);
test0(S({1, 2, 2}), 1, S({2, 2}), 1);
test0(S({1, 2, 2}), 2, S({1}), 2);
test0(S({1, 2, 2}), 3, S({1, 2, 2}), 0);
// Test cross-type erasure
using opt = std::optional<typename S::value_type>;
test0(S({1, 2, 1}), opt(), S({1, 2, 1}), 0);
test0(S({1, 2, 1}), opt(1), S({2}), 2);
test0(S({1, 2, 1}), opt(2), S({1, 1}), 1);
test0(S({1, 2, 1}), opt(3), S({1, 2, 1}), 0);
}
int main(int, char**)
{
test<std::list<int>>();
test<std::list<int, min_allocator<int>>> ();
test<std::list<int, test_allocator<int>>> ();
test<std::list<long>>();
test<std::list<double>>();
return 0;
}
